I was reading through your blogs on the Richardson lines and came across this blog and remembered the names of Hegwer and Danes, so I began looking through my records and searching online for records with these names. I found a 1900 census from Precinct 8 in Colorado which lists Moses Liverman, age 51 born in Missouri, Jennie, Liverman age 36 born in Illinois, and Kenneth Liverman, age 6 born in Colorado. He is the right age for the Kenneth in the newspaper article. Jennie is the name of the woman listed with Kenneth in the household of the McCrackens. Moses mother Teresa is also in the census and she is from Germany. Kenneth and his mother both went to Germany.<br />Then I found an 1870 U. S. Census for Nebraska which lists an Albert Danes born in Illinois in 1857 with a sister, Jennie, born in Illinois in 1864. I think all of these records are for Jennie Danes Liverman. I run the Ohio Gho...Hello, My name is Glenn Morris. I run the Ohio Ghost Town Exploration Co. & totally agree on this subject! Most of the history of the counties books can be found, read, & searched on google ebooks. They are a treasure trove of information from the past. The people that wrote & contributed to the books, some of which are over 100 years old, knew a lot more about the old towns in Ohio than anyone today could possibly know. I'll amend the post to alert future readers to be sure to read your explanation.MHDh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/16428311664931882466no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-5227235601381982501.post-3995892187100728092012-08-12T17:53:11.690-07:002012-08-12T17:53:11.690-07:00There's nothing strange about the page where t...There's nothing strange about the page where there appears to be a hodge-podge of names and addresses.<br /><br />If you looked at the sheet # of that page, you would see it's 61A. This and higher sheet numbers were reserved for people missed on the first sweep of the enumerator through the neighborhood. S/he might not have found the family at home, or only had information about part of the adults there, left an absentee blank form to be filled out, and then later picked them up. Those forms were transferred, per the enumerator's instructions, to a sheet with the number 61A or higher (regardless of what the actual page number was in the ED's sequence.)<br /><br />Notice on this page you can see the Family #, and you can then go back to previous pages to see the "main" household members.<br /><br />Joel Weintraub<br />Dana Point, CAUnknownh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/03427311250015261520no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-5227235601381982501.post-49035025379272740692012-08-12T13:56:37.460-07:002012-08-12T13:56:37.460-07:00Happy blogiversary!Happy blogiversary!Amy Coffin, MLIShttps://www.blogger.com/profile/00612044786240692282no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-5227235601381982501.post-66840592973170713182012-08-11T12:01:44.780-07:002012-08-11T12:01:44.780-07:00Happy Blogiversary!-Enjoyed your census story.Happy Blogiversary!-Enjoyed your census story.Lisahttps://www.blogger.com/profile/11686141155733545208noreply@blogger.com
